Compost covers the dirt and prevents crusting, compaction, and water dissipation. Mulch covers the soil and avoids crusting, compaction, and water evaporation.

With fewer weeds, less growing is called for, which can stop damage to plant origins, dirt framework, and dirt microorganisms. In enhancement, compost moderates dirt temperature and secures plant origins.

Organic composts include materials such as wood or bark chips, shredded bark, nut shells, want needles, or various other disposed of plant components. These materials have the prospective to improve soil structure, increase dirt fertility, avoid compaction, and increase dirt raw material as they break down and are integrated right into the soil.

To ensure ample water infiltration and aeration and to slow decomposition, see to it compost bits are larger than the underlying soil fragments (normally bigger than a fifty percent inch in size). Recycled plant materials need to be without weed seeds, disease-causing organisms, and pesticide and herbicide residues. You can either utilize healthsome plant parts that have not been chemically dealt with, or you can compost your compost before usage.

Nitrogen loss can be prevented by utilizing composted compost or by including nitrogen at a price of 1-2 pounds actual N per 1000 ft2. In time, natural composts break down and will certainly need to be replenished. Replenishment can be completed simply by including more mulch over the top of the decayed compost material.

The choice concerning which to make use of will certainly depend upon the type of landscape, the factor for its usage, and its availability. Instances consist of gravel or crushed stone, lava rock, recycled toppled glass, and rocks of various sizes, shapes, and shades. The dimension of inorganic compost particles need to enhance the scale of the landscape.

A 2-inch thick layer of compost needs about 6 cubic backyards of material per 1000 square feet of location. Leave a few inches of mulch-free area around the base of woody plants to stop root collar diseases and rodent damage. The ideal time to apply compost is instantly after planting in the fall, or in the spring after the soil has actually warmed.

In enhancement to preserving water, proper irrigation can motivate deeper origin development and much healthier, more dry spell tolerant landscapes. An important element of water-efficient landscaping is developing hydrozones for your watering requires. To supply appropriate water to all plants without over or under-watering some, group plants with similar irrigation requires in one area.

One more vital facet of watering preparation consists of regular upkeep of the system. Regular monthly assessment of the irrigation system, while in usage, will help you to locate and repair any damaged, misaligned, or blocked lawn sprinkler heads and keep your system running successfully. Drip Irrigation systems includes plastic pipelines with emitters that provide water straight to plants.

Plan and design irrigation systems to make sure that turfgrass locations are irrigated independently from other landscape plants. There are several resources readily available to establish the proper watering routine for lawn locations in Utah. from the Utah Department of Water Resources from the Utah Division of Water Resources Trees and shrubs have much deeper and a lot more substantial root systems than turfgrass so they must be watered much less regularly however for longer amount of times.

It is important to identify sub-surface dirt moisture. Dirt wetness can be determined utilizing a soil moisture probe. Trees or bushes must be watered to a deepness of 18-20 inches. The quantity of water to apply in any scenario depends upon the soil type. Sandy dirts take in water the fastest (about 2" per hour), complied with by loam soils (3/4" per hour).

By permitting water to permeate much deeper right into the soil account, you are encouraging deeper rooting and an even more dry spell forgiving plant. Constant, light watering will certainly result in plants that have a superficial root system and that are a lot more prone to water stress. A lot of deciduous shrubs (shrubs that drop their fallen leaves in fall) benefit from thinning cuts that open up their canopy and get rid of old or completing stems - Green Landscaping Company Santa Fe Springs. Thinning cuts are made by cutting a branch back to its point of beginning. The point of origin can be one more branch or the main trunk, or maybe near the ground

A heading cut is extra serious than a thinning cut, and gets rid of component of a branch leaving a short stub over a bud. This type of cut promotes a wealth of twiggy growth from a lateral bud just below the cut. It is utilized to boost new growth from a side bud to fill out a gap in the canopy, or to enhance blossom manufacturing in some shrubs.

Overuse of heading cuts can wreck the all-natural shape of a tree or bush. Shearing is the most severe kind of heading cut and involves reducing a plant's outer foliage to create an even surface area. Only particular trees and hedges will certainly benefit from this sort of cut. Shearing can be made use of to develop a bush or screen with closely spaced plants.
